Esse artigo descreve como os atributos de usuário personalizados podem ser definidos e usados na Luma.
Visão geral
Além dos campos de perfil de usuário padrão fornecidos pelo sistema, os usuários podem precisar de alguns campos adicionais específicos de usuário. Na Luma, um administrador de inquilinos pode definir uma lista de Atributos de usuário personalizados que pode manter as informações de usuário específicas à sua organização, como localização, IDs de anúncios, designação, etc. Esses valores podem ser usados para autorização de usuário e sincronização de dados do usuário, ou podem ser referidos durante a criação de uma habilidade na ramificação ou como informações a serem transmitidas por meio da carga de saída de integrações.
A Luma permite que um inquilino tenha no máximo de 15 Atributos de usuário personalizados.
O valor de um Atributo de usuário personalizado pode ser preenchido por meio do Upload de dados em massa ou pela sincronização de dados por meio de APIs. Como alternativa, ele também pode ser definido durante a inicialização da sessão por meio de um canal de bate-papo configurado ou em uma habilidade, assim como qualquer outro parâmetro de conversa. O escopo desses atributos é global, ou seja, o valor será mantido, a menos que seja substituído.
Semelhante aos atributos Locais e Globais na Luma, esses atributos também podem ser usados em Habilidades e Operações. Eles podem ser referidos como @{user.}
Para exibir a lista de Atributos de usuário personalizados definidos para o inquilino, vá até Inquilino → Gestão de usuários → guia Atributos de usuário personalizados. Como administrador, você pode criar, no máximo, 15 atributos para seu inquilino.
Criar um atributo de usuário personalizado
Siga estas etapas para criar um Atributo de suário personalizado para seu inquilino:
Na guia Atributo de usuário personalizado, clique em Criar atributo de usuário personalizado.
Na tela de detalhes, adicione o atributo Nome.
O identificador será gerado automaticamente pelo sistema com base no nome. É possível editar o identificador, se necessário.
Selecione o tipo de dado com base no tipo de valor que o atributo manterá.
Quando todos os detalhes obrigatórios forem preenchidos, clique em Criar para criar o atributo.
No máximo, 10 atributos podem ser definidos para um inquilino.
Cada Atributo de usuário personalizado deve ser exclusivo.
Depois que o Identificador e o Tipo de dado do atributo forem criados, eles não poderão ser atualizados.
Pesquisar e exibir um Atributo de usuário personalizado
A lista Atributos de usuário personalizados pode ser filtrada usando o atributo Nome ou Identificador. Siga as etapas abaixo para pesquisar um atributo na lista:
Na lista Atributos de usuário personalizados, digite o texto no campo Pesquisar e pressione Enter.
A lista agora é filtrada de acordo com os critérios de pesquisa.
Selecione o atributo necessário para exibir os detalhes.
Editar atributo de usuário personalizado
Para editar um Atributo de usuário personalizado existente, siga este procedimento:
Na lista Atributos de usuário personalizados, selecione o atributo necessário.
Na tela de detalhes, clique em Editar.
Agora, apenas o campo Nome do atributo pode ser editado. Atualize o campo, conforme necessário.
Clique em Salvar para salvar as alterações.
Usando um atributo de usuário personalizado
Os atributos de usuário personalizados definidos para o inquilino podem ser usados em toda a Luma para exibir informações específicas do usuário. Quando usado em uma habilidade ou em operações como carga de saída, eles podem ser referidos como @{user.}.
Por exemplo:
Usando o atributo de usuário personalizado na mensagem informativa em uma habilidade:
Usando o atributo de usuário personalizado na operação: